+ Vector3* HUDNavigation::toAimPosition(RadarViewable* target) const
+ {
+ Vector3 wePosition = HumanController::getLocalControllerSingleton()->getControllableEntity()->getWorldPosition();
+ Vector3 targetPosition = target->getRVWorldPosition();
+ Vector3 targetSpeed = target->getRVOrientedVelocity();
+
+ // munSpeed*time = lengthBetween(wePosition, targetPosition + targetSpeed*time)
+ // from this we extract:
+ float a = pow(targetSpeed.length(),2) - pow(this->currentMunitionSpeed_,2);
+ float b = 2*((targetPosition.x - wePosition.x)*targetSpeed.x
+ +(targetPosition.y - wePosition.y)*targetSpeed.y
+ +(targetPosition.z - wePosition.z)*targetSpeed.z);
+ float c = pow((targetPosition-wePosition).length(),2);
+
+ // calculate smallest time solution, in case it exists
+ if(pow(b,2) - 4*a*c < 0)
+ return NULL;
+ float time = (-b - sqrt(pow(b,2) - 4*a*c))/(2*a);
+ if(time < 0)
+ time = (-b + sqrt(pow(b,2) - 4*a*c))/(2*a);
+ if(time < 0)
+ return NULL;
+ Vector3* result = new Vector3(targetPosition + targetSpeed * time);
+ return result;
+ }
